A workflow diagram visualizes the steps, tasks, and decisions involved in a specific business process. It provides a clear and structured representation of how work should flow from start to finish, helping organizations streamline their operations and improve efficiency.

The Components of a Workflow Diagram

A workflow diagram typically consists of several key components:

  1. Start and end points: Represent the initial and final states of the process.
  2. Tasks and subtasks: Represent individual actions or steps involved in the process.
  3. Decisions: Indicate points where alternative paths or choices can arise.
  4. Arrows: Show the flow of work from one step to another.

**Workflow diagrams** use various symbols and notations to represent these components, such as rectangles for tasks, diamonds for decisions, and arrows to connect them. They can be created using specialized software or with pen and paper, depending on the complexity of the process. The diagram’s simplicity or complexity will depend on the level of detail needed to understand and improve the workflow.

Types of Workflow Diagrams

Workflow diagrams can take various forms depending on the specific requirements of the process. The following table outlines a few types of workflow diagrams:

Type Description
Process Flowchart Displays the sequential steps of a process using standardized symbols.
Data Flow Diagram Focuses on the movement of data within the process.
Swimlane Diagram Illustrates the flow of work across different departments or individuals.
Value Stream Mapping Highlights the activities required to deliver value to the customer.
Deployment Flowchart Shows the physical or logical deployment of resources in a process.

Workflow Diagram Best Practices

While creating workflow diagrams, it is essential to adhere to certain best practices to ensure clarity and effectiveness. The following table highlights some valuable tips for creating efficient workflow diagrams:

Best Practice Description
Keep It Simple Avoid overcrowding the diagram and focus on presenting the essential elements.
Use Consistent Symbols Maintain uniformity in symbol usage across the diagram for better understanding.
Label Clearly Ensure all labels and descriptions are clear, concise, and easily readable.
Include Key Decision Points Highlight decision points that impact the workflow to guide users appropriately.
Review and Validate Regularly review and validate the workflow diagram with relevant stakeholders.
